
DISTRICT LEADERSHIP CONFERENCE (DLC)
The District Leadership Conference offers training to the laity and clergy through a variety of training classes. If you are new to a committee the DLC is for you. If you have served on a committee for awhile the DLC is still for you because forms and policies change. These changes are always covered in the DLC classes. Pastors the DLC is for you too!
